Binghamton Rumble Ponies Capture Eastern League Crown With 8-2 Game 3 Win in Erie
The triumph is the club’s first championship since 2014, ending Erie’s pursuit of a three-peat.
Overview
- Binghamton clinched the best-of-three series with an 8-2 victory over the SeaWolves on Sept. 24 at UPMC Park.
- Jacob Reimer’s sixth-inning solo homer broke a 2-2 tie before Chris Suero added a two-run shot, and Suero finished with four RBIs.
- Starter Jack Wenninger struck out 11 over five innings while allowing two runs, and the bullpen (Joander Suarez, TJ Shook, Carlos Guzman) closed it out.
- The Rumble Ponies’ offense tallied 14 hits, highlighted by D’Andre Smith’s 3-for-5 night with two runs and three RBIs.
- The series swung after Erie’s 14-5 Game 1 win as Binghamton answered with a 5-4 Game 2 comeback, then secured the franchise’s fourth title and first as the Rumble Ponies.
